## Artifact Signing — Broker Upgrade Builds

All Mirestream broker upgrade packages must be signed before promotion. Contractors: build the 5.x migration bundle, run the compatibility suite, and confirm queue-drain scripts are included. The promotion gate rejects unsigned artifacts without exception. Once checks pass, sign the bundle using the key below.

rollout seal: bky9_aBG1gvAyU

Subject: On-call heads-up — Orchardly catalog cache. Welcome aboard. The main gotcha: catalog price updates invalidate by SKU, but bundle pages cache composite keys, so a stale bundle can outlive its parts. If support reports wrong bundle prices, purge the composite namespace first. We'll cover this at the weekly sync; the invalidation playbook is on this internal page.

wiki page, yagef-tawif: https://sentry.lumicdata.local/view/merge_requests/pipeline/merge_requests/e08f7f35c80b5755

Handover — Vexler partner SFTP drop

Ownership moves to you today. Drop runs hourly from Vexler's end into the intake bucket via the relay host. Watch for zero-byte files; their exporter flakes on Mondays. Creds live in the ops vault, path noted in the runbook. Vault auto-seals after 48h idle. Support escalations go to the on-call rotation, not me. If the vault is sealed when you need it, unseal with the recovery passphrase below.

recovery phrase for tadug-fafof: zorwyn-kasion